Earning Power of Mr Bean Media Rights

Television Revenue Streams

Broadcast sales of the original episodes continue to generate income for distributors and rightsholders. International syndication, streaming platform licenses, and repeats on holiday channels create a stable baseline for Mr Bean net worth above one time box office results.

Film Royalties and Performance Bonuses

Box office hits like Bean (1997) and Mr Bean’s Holiday (2007) trigger backend profit participation for the performer and producers. When these films appear on premium cable or airline licensing menus, they add recurring revenue tied to usage rather than flat fees.

Global Brand Value and Licensing Strategy

The Mr Bean character functions as a low language dependent icon that fits neatly into family friendly marketing campaigns. Companies pay substantial fees to align products with a figure associated with harmless slapstick and broad audience recognition.

Merchandise and Product Tie Ins

From plush toys to kitchen gadgets, Mr Bean branded items command shelf space because they tap into cross generational nostalgia. Retailers prioritize placements that highlight recognizable props such as the Mini and the teddy, which sustain long tail sales.

Theme Park and Experiential Appearances

Theme park zones featuring comedy scenarios with Mr Bean create photo opportunities that drive attendance. These installations often include meet and greets, queue entertainment, and limited time shows that reinforce top of mind awareness.

Career Decisions That Shaped Mr Bean Net Worth

Strategic Silence and Visual Comedy

Limiting dialogue allowed the character to travel easily across markets without costly dubbing or script rewrites. This choice expanded distribution windows and reduced localization expenses, improving profit margins on both television and film deals.

Selective Project Approvals

By appearing in fewer projects but with tightly controlled brand usage, the performer maintained premium pricing. Scarcity of new content can increase demand for legacy libraries, supporting higher fees for reruns and licensing negotiations tied to Mr Bean net worth growth.
